I love to quilt, and would like to make a new winter quilt block swap. I recomend signing up soon, as space is limited. I'm starting now to give us 2 monthes (if needed) to get the 12 quilters I would prefer to have for the exchange.

We each should make twelve 12.5" x 12.5" blocks that incorporte some winter colors and at least a piece or two of wintery fabric into the block. Feel free to make your favorite block, and come show a pic of the design or tell us, if you wish it. I think we should make the blocks due January 25th. I'm open to a block theme, if anyone want to make it more specific. Otherwise, I like sampler quilts, so all us all may show off our unique tastes and preferences.

I am on BYC every single day, and I will absolutely be available to answer questions, and all who send blocks will receive blocks from whomever else takes part. I ask that when you ship your blocks, add a large SASE (self addressed stamped envelope) for easy block shipment. However many blocks we each receive is dependant on how many quilters take part.

Good Morning all! I am going to make the Hole in Barn Door square for my squares. This is a 12" block, so will it work?

It's from quilterscache.com: http://www.quilterscache.com/H/HoleintheBarnDoorBlock.html

Marty1876, will you let me know if the 12" will work please? Thank you!!

The 12 inch blocks on that site are actually a 12 1/2 inch per block and when you have them all sewn together into a finshed quilt, they will measure 12". So you should be good to go with that pattern.
